Abstract

The invention discloses a kind of environmentally friendly self-heating pan, it is made up of pan and heating preparation, the pot is made up of inner pan body and outer pan body, pot interlayer is formed between the inner pan body and outer pan body, the opening communicated with pot interlayer is provided with the top of the pot, the pot interlayer, which is internally provided with, meets the heating preparation that water discharges heat.Using above-mentioned technical proposal, due to pot is arranged into sandwich, while heating preparation is placed in interlayer, and the top design of pot has the opening of connection interlayer, intake by opening, heating preparation reaction release heat can be made, so as to be heated to the water in interlayer, then heated interior pot by heat transfer, without electricity consumption or naked light is used during the pan heating of the present invention, the pan of the present invention is easy to carry in addition, does not also discharge waste gas influential on environment, safety and environmental protection during heating.

Description

A kind of environmentally friendly self-heating pan
Technical field
The present invention relates to the manufacture field of pan, more particularly to a kind of environmentally friendly self-heating pan.
Background technology
Traditional pan is usually to be made up of heater and pot, and heater uses electricity consumption, burns coal, combusts The traditional heating modes such as gas, log fire, the pan of the type disclosure satisfy that the requirement of family expenses, but due to needing electricity consumption or with fire, On the one hand there are problems that potential safety hazard, discharge waste gas, on the other hand the pan can not be applied to family and field simultaneously, and with The raising of outdoor travel temperature, people are to outdoor requirement also more and more higher, i.e., heating to food and drink, the demand heated up water are got over Come higher, and the pan caused by using traditional heating mode carries inconvenient at present, there is potential safety hazard during heating Problem can not be still resolved.
Therefore, one kind is needed badly easy to carry, it is safe, while the pan of heating requirements can also be met.
The content of the invention
The technical problem to be solved in the present invention is to provide a kind of environmentally friendly self-heating pan, the pan avoids traditional use Electricity, burn coal, combust gas, log fire mode of heating, heating process can be completed without electricity consumption and fire, while heating process is acyclic Border is polluted, in the absence of potential safety hazard, and whole pan is easy to carry.
A kind of environmentally friendly self-heating pan, is made up of, pot is made up of inner pan body and outer pan body, interior pan and heating preparation Formed between pot and outer pan body at the top of pot interlayer, pot and be provided with the opening communicated with interlayer, interlayer is internally provided with chance Water is the heating preparation for discharging heat.
Preferably, heating preparation be made up of component A and B component, component A in potassium, the monovalent metal oxide of sodium extremely Few one kind, B component is hydrochloric acid solid.
It is further preferred that component A and B component are by weight 1:1 composition.
Still further preferably, component A is sodium oxide molybdena, and B component is hydrochloric acid solid.
Preferably, it is provided with closure in pot opening.
Preferably, it is provided with handle at the top of pot.
Preferably, pot is in from top to bottom inverted cone-shaped structure.
Using above-mentioned technical proposal, due to pot is arranged into sandwich, while heating preparation is placed in interlayer, and The top design of pot has the opening of connection interlayer, is intake by opening, you can make heating preparation reaction release heat, so that right Water in interlayer is heated, then is heated interior pot by heat transfer, without electricity consumption or use when pan of the invention is heated Naked light, pan of the invention is easy to carry in addition, does not also discharge waste gas influential on environment, safety and environmental protection during heating.
Brief description of the drawings
Fig. 1 is the structural representation of the embodiment of the present invention.
Embodiment
The embodiment to the present invention is described further below in conjunction with the accompanying drawings.Herein it should be noted that for The explanation of these embodiments is used to help understand the present invention, but does not constitute limitation of the invention.In addition, disclosed below As long as each of the invention embodiment in involved technical characteristic do not constitute conflict each other and can just be mutually combined.
As illustrated, the present invention's is made up of pan and heating preparation, pot is made up of inner pan body and outer pan body, interior pot Formed between body and outer pan body at the top of pot interlayer, pot and be provided with the opening communicated with interlayer, interlayer is internally provided with chance water Discharge the heating preparation of heat.The heating preparation can be by least one of monovalent metal oxide of potassium or sodium, hydrochloric acid solid Composition, it distinguishes the difference for being to discharge heat, but its principle is consistent, therefore in the present embodiment only with sodium oxide molybdena and hydrochloric acid Solid is by weight 1:1 is mixed, by carrying out 1:The sodium hydroxide that 1 be mixed with generates after being reacted beneficial to sodium oxide molybdena and water Fully reacted with hydrochloric acid, realize the maximization of heat release.
Opening at the top of pot, which can be set, one, may be alternatively provided as two, and in order to reduce thermal loss, optimal side Open amount is limited to one or two by case, and the present embodiment uses two openings, while in order to further reduce heat Loss, closure is provided with pot opening.
And the movement of pot for convenience, particularly prevent from scalding in heating, can handle be set at the top of pot, handle There are two.And in order to further keep heat, pot is from top to bottom arranged to inverted cone-shaped structure, the process heat that adds water can be delayed The forfeiture of amount.
The operating method of pan when in use is as follows:
The food that need to be heated, water or other articles are positioned in inner pan body first, then open closure, first toward folder Poured water in layer, inflow accounts for the 80% of interlayer volume, then toward adding by weight 1 in interlayer:The 1 heating preparation prepared, Preparation reacts after water is run into, and reaction equation is Na2O+2HCL=2NaCl+H2O, sodium oxide molybdena meets life after reaction after water with hydrochloric acid Into sodium chloride (component of salt) and water, and substantial amounts of heat is discharged, this heat first can be the water in chuck pan More than 80-100 DEG C is warming up to, food, water or other articles for needing to process are transferred heat in the metal level by inner pan body, So as to reach heating food effect can be completed without using electricity and naked light.And for the situation of shortage of heat, using process In can carry out at any time generate heat preparation addition, depending on its usage amount is according to live heating state.And used due to the present invention Heating preparation produces exothermic reaction when meeting water, will not produce and use pernicious gas, and reacted liquid is anti-by acid-base neutralization Should, can directly scene outwell, will not to environment generation harmful effect.
And the present invention be by pot with heating preparation cooperation, and pot and heating preparation be it is individually placed, only Need that just heating preparation is allocated and added into pot interlayer when in use, thus it is easy to carry, solve outdoor travel, field Spend a holiday, the problem that field survivorship etc. needs to heat food and heated up water etc..
